An opportunity has arisen for an experienced Building Surveyor to join our Direct Maintenance team within L&Q’s North East patch covering Waltham Forest, Havering and surrounding areas.
The role reports into the Maintenance Team Manager and is responsible for giving expert advice to the team on property surveying matters.
You will have a wide range of specialist skills including property surveying, both internal and external and a good understanding of construction and building methods gained by previous experience in a similar role.
Health and safety is of paramount importance in this role and we expect our Surveyors to be able to demonstrate a good knowledge of Health and Safety and compliance at all times.
The Direct Maintenance Surveyors will have a knowledge of contract and housing law and will have ideally worked for Housing Associations or Local Authorities.
A large part of this role will involve carrying out inspections on L&Q properties, then providing technical advice to the team and managing complex projects including liaising with residents and contractors, and other third parties as necessary. Candidates will have had extensive experience in carrying out specifications of jobs and will be confident in providing costings and recommendations. You will be able to produce condition reports.
Customer Service is at the forefront of everything we do. Our Surveyors will aim to create a positive impact on our residents lives and will be passionate and act with determination to resolve resident complaints and issues.
You will be able to influence a wide range of internal and external stakeholders and will have excellent communication skills. You will have had experience working with contractors and managing contracts.

L&Q is a regulated charitable housing association and one of the UK’s most successful independent social businesses. The L&Q Group houses around 250,000 people in more than 100,000 homes, primarily across London and the South East.
As a charitable organisation, our role goes beyond providing homes and housing services. We are a long-term partner in the neighbourhoods where we work. We hope to build aspiration, opportunity and confidence in our communities through our £250 million L&Q Foundation and our skills academy.
Our vision is that everyone has a quality home they can afford, and we combine our social purpose with commercial drive to create homes and neighbourhoods everyone can be proud of.
